When applying a horizontal force of 30N, an object of mass 6 kg accelerates at 4m/s2. The force of friction on the surface must be ___ N

Respuesta :

Using Newton's Second Law, F = ma, where F is the net force

So the net force is:

F = (6kg)(4m/s^2) = 24N

Since you are applying a horizontal force of 30N, we can find the force of friction by the difference of the net force and the applied force.

30N-24N = 6N

[tex]F_{f} = 6N[/tex]
